			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A 1.0-liter Ford Focus might seem to be not very attractive on paper, but once you realize that it arrives in 98-bhp guise with a 5-speed manual and 123 bhp with a 6-speed linked to it, then the picture changes to some degree.<br />
<img id="il_fi" class="aligncenter" src="http://media.caranddriver.com/images/12q2/450432/2012-ford-focus-10l-ecoboost-first-drive-review-car-and-driver-photo-455840-s-429x262.jpg" alt="" width="429" height="262" /><span id="more-876"></span>Understanding that it’s a 3-cylinder might take the glimmer off it as well, particularly since Ford hasn’t bothered to set up a balancer shaft to iron out the 3-potter’s odd frequencies.</p>
<p><img id="il_fi" class="aligncenter" src="http://image.motortrend.com/f/36792454+w786+ar1/2012-Ford-Focus-EcoBoost-engine-2.jpg" alt="" width="432" height="289" />But you’d be wrong on all matters. This is a treasure of an engine.  Because of cleverly tuned engine mounts and a flywheel and front pulley that are perfectly out of balance to counteract those unwanted vibrations, it runs as smoothly as any 4- or 6-cylinder unit. Besides, once you get past 2000 rpm, it pulls powerfully and willingly especially around the 3500 mark where the transient overboost offers a 30-second overboost that sees torque climb from 125 to 148 lbs.-ft.</p>
<p><img class="aligncenter" title="2012 Ford Focus 1.0L EcoBoost" src="http://blog.roadandtrack.com/wp-content/uploads/1.0-litre-Ford-EcoBoost-turbo-petrol-engine-440x268.jpg" alt="2012 Ford Focus 1.0L EcoBoost" width="440" height="268" /></p>
<p>A further plus point is its long-legged motorway cruising with under 2500 rpm on the tacho in 6th gear and, I think, heavy loads might blunt its willingness to perform, but as the gearbox is a joy to use that’s no hardship.</p>
<p>The ride is as fluent as you’d expect any Focus to be and the steering, due to the engine taking 66 lb. off the nose, is even sharper and more agile under passionate cornering than before – also followed by electric power steering uniquely tuned for this application.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img id="il_fi" class="alignleft" title="Underinflated Tires" src="http://www.chicagotribune.com/media/photo/2010-06/54487258.jpg" alt="Underinflated Tires" width="283" height="158" />A study by NHTSA looked at crash data from 2005-2007&#8211;before tire-pressure monitoring systems were required to be installed on all cars. The systems mandated for the 2008 model year alert drivers if any tire drops 25% or more below the recommended inflation level of your car. Tire pressure monitoring systems are created to alert a driver of a tire losing air pressure and are not intended to be used as an alternative for monthly tire pressure checks.</p>
<p><span id="more-869"></span>The study also found that five percent of all vehicles studied experienced tire problems immediately before a crash, with 66 percent of those representing passenger vehicles, 17% being SUVs, and the rest being pickups and vans. Half of the tire-related crashes involved a single car, and just 31%of single vehicle crashes were not associated with tires.</p>
<p><img id="il_fi" class="alignright" src="http://images1.vat19.com/tireGauge/HandHolding.jpg" alt="" width="267" height="198" />This shows that tire problems are evident in the pre-crash phase, which has a very small window for attempting a crash avoidance maneuver. Rollovers are more common among SUVs that experienced a tire problem before a crash&#8211;45 percent rolled over. On the other hand, passenger cars, pickups, and vans experiencing tire problems had fewer than a 25 percent incidence of rollover. Overall, the study concluded that tire problems in the pre-crash phase were more likely to lead in rollover in SUVs than other types of vehicles.</p>
<p>Tire problems combined with other factors, such as bad weather or an inexperienced driver, can increase the likelihood of a crash.</p>
<p><img id="il_fi" class="alignleft" src="http://www.aircompressorsdirect.com/images/stories/submitted/review_id_1160_image3_girl_inflating_car_tire_338.jpg" alt="" width="223" height="186" />Aside from properly inflating your tires, it is very important to monitor your tire tread depth condition. This study showed that tire-related crashes were more likely as your tire&#8217;s tread wears, with accident rates at just 2.4 percent when tires had near full tread depth to 26 percent when the tires were worn- out. We recommend consumers start shopping for new tires at 4/32&#8243; tread depth while some all-weather grip is still available. At this point tire-related crashes approached 8 percent.</p>
<p>A 2009 NHTSA analysis found that 57 % of vehicles with tire-pressure monitoring systems had tires that were properly inflated.</p>
<p>The study reiterates the need for motorists to properly maintain tires. Buying a tire pressure gauge and regularly checking your pressure can help avoid these tire problems and the increase risk of a related crash.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The New Hampshire Motor Speedway typically echoes with the screech and whine of NASCAR events, but things were a bit quieter this weekend as student-built hybrids and EVs and took over the track for the sixth annual Formula Hybrid competition.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.carpartfreaks.com/carpartsblog/wp-content/uploads/2012/05/formula-hybrid-1.jpg"><img class="alignright size-full wp-image-851" title="formula-hybrid-1" src="http://www.carpartfreaks.com/carpartsblog/wp-content/uploads/2012/05/formula-hybrid-1.jpg" alt="" width="670" height="446" /></a></p>
<p><span id="more-850"></span><!--more-->Taking top honors in the hybrid class this year were both Brigham Young University of Utah and Université de Sherbrooke in Quebec. The two teams had remarkably similar scores which were too close for judges to call, so the first place finish was shared. Last year, BYU took second place overall and won the endurance event. We’ve included some video of BYU’s acceleration trial and the Canadian team’s autocross run.</p>
<p><iframe src="http://www.youtube.com/embed/DGoEA2jxfao?feature=player_embedded" frameborder="0" width="640" height="360"></iframe></p>
<p>This year, 36 teams from all over the world taken part in the event, which was started by Dartmouth’s Thayer School of Engineering back in 2006. The competition itself is dependant on the Formula SAE program – other than with a focus on energy conservation and electric propulsion. The 2012 competition was the largest so far with schools from Taiwan, Brazil and India in attendance. It’s a big jump from 2007, when only six teams competed.</p>
<p><iframe src="http://www.youtube.com/embed/eqvSMlanHII?feature=player_embedded" frameborder="0" width="640" height="360"></iframe></p>
<p>Students have a year to build their vehicles and can retrofit one they’ve already entered in Formula SAE. They can also reuse a chassis over multiple years, but must abide by a strict set of rules. The majority of teams in competition have existing student motorsports programs, and have competed in other speed and endurance events.</p>
<p>Typically, the spotlight of the race is the endurance event, where teams are provided only 5,555 watt hours of energy to complete a 13.67 mile race. In comparison, that’s about how much electricity a space heater consumes in less than four hours. Furthermore, cars must compete in acceleration trials and in an autocross event. Teams are also judged on marketing and design.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div id="attachment_41256"><img title="1948 Ferrari 166 Inter Spyder Corsa" src="http://www.sportscardigest.com/wp-content/uploads/1948-Ferrari-166-Inter-Spyder-Corsa1-620x410.jpg" alt="1948 Ferrari 166 Inter Spyder Corsa1 620x410 RM Auctions Monaco 2012   Auction Preview" width="620" height="410" />1948 Ferrari 166 Spider Corsa &#8211; Estimate €1.100.000 – €1.800.000. Chassis number 012I was the ninth Ferrari in chassis sequence and the sixth 166 Spider Corsa built. The car boasts an extensive period race history, first with Scuderia Ferrari and later with Scuderia Marzotto, for whom it was rebodied in 1950 in the Barchetta style by Carrozzeria Fontana. <span id="more-832"></span>The car’s competition portfolio in the 1948 to 1952 period includes two Mille Miglias and two Targa Florios, during which time it was piloted by such notable drivers as Bracco, Maglioli, Frolian Gonzales and the Marzotto brothers. Chassis number 012I was recently restored to concours quality condition and is ready to participate in any postwar historic racing or touring event.</div>
<div></div>
<div></div>
<div id="attachment_41256">
<div id="attachment_41266"><img title="1969 Alfa Romeo Tipo 33/3" src="http://www.sportscardigest.com/wp-content/uploads/1969-Alfa-Romeo-Tipo-33-3-Sports-Racer-620x412.jpg" alt="1969 Alfa Romeo Tipo 33 3 Sports Racer 620x412 RM Auctions Monaco 2012   Auction Preview" width="620" height="412" />1969 Alfa Romeo Tipo 33/3 &#8211; Estimate €600.000 – €700.000. Chassis 10580-023, the ex-works Autodelta Group 6 car. Developed for the 1970 championship season, the T33/3 features a 3-litre V8 engine capable of producing in excess 420 bhp and a competition history with the Autodelta team, where the car was shared by De Adamich and Piers Courage during the 1970 season.</div>
<div></div>
<div></div>
<div id="attachment_41255"><img title="1968 Alfa Romeo Tipo 33/2 Daytona" src="http://www.sportscardigest.com/wp-content/uploads/Alfa-Romeo-Tipo-33-Daytona-Full1-620x412.jpg" alt="Alfa Romeo Tipo 33 Daytona Full1 620x412 RM Auctions Monaco 2012   Auction Preview" width="620" height="412" />1968 Alfa Romeo Tipo 33/2 Daytona &#8211; Estimate €900,000 &#8211; €1,100,000. Chassis 75033-029. One of a select few built for the 1968 international season, this example boasts one of the few vetted racing histories by marque experts, who contend it was driven to victory at the 500-km Imola race by racing luminaries Nino Vaccarella and Teodoro Zeccoli, in addition to performances at Monza, Targa Florio and Zeltweg, among other events. Described as one of the best and most original examples in existence, it is reportedly ‘on the button’ and ready to go, both road registered and an active participant in a variety of leading historic events in recent years.</div>
<div></div>
<div></div>
</div>
<div id="attachment_41265"><img title="1974 Ferrari 308 GT4/LM" src="http://www.sportscardigest.com/wp-content/uploads/1974-Ferrari-308-GT4-LM-620x413.jpg" alt="1974 Ferrari 308 GT4 LM 620x413 RM Auctions Monaco 2012   Auction Preview" width="620" height="413" />1974 Ferrari 308 GT4/LM &#8211; Estimate €580.000 – €680.000. Chassis number 08020; one-off built by the factory to compete at the 24 Hours of Le Mans. Entered in the 1974 Le Mans 24 hours by NART, driven by Giancarlo Gagliardi and Jean-Louis Lafosse, where it failed to finish after having clutch issues. After its brief racing career, 08020 was retained by Luigi Chinetti before being sold. The current owner has brought the car back to full running order.</div>
<div></div>
<div></div>
<div id="attachment_41265">
<div id="attachment_41257"><img title="1950 Talbot-Lago T26 GS" src="http://www.sportscardigest.com/wp-content/uploads/1950-Talbot-Lago-T26-GS1-620x410.jpg" alt="1950 Talbot Lago T26 GS1 620x410 RM Auctions Monaco 2012   Auction Preview" width="620" height="410" />1950 Talbot-Lago T26 GS &#8211; Estimate €1.150.000 – €1.500.000. Chassis number 110057. Only three owners since being sold by the factory in 1951. It has been raced by its current owner for over fifty years. The car’s period race record includes Fangio, Rosier, Trintignant, Mairesse and Grignard. Twice entered for the Le Mans 24 Hour races, including the 1952 race in the hands of Rosier and Fangio, it also participated in the 1952 Monaco Grand Prix with Rosier and Trintignant.</div>
